Dúvida eclipse: pacote 'javax.servlet....' não aparece no import

4 respostas
leorbarbosa

Boa tarde,

estou criando um ‘Dynamic Web Project’ no Eclipse e, ao definir os imports da aplicação, o pacote ‘javax.servlet…’ não aparece para ser importado.

Qual configuração devo realizar?
O tipo de projeto está correto?

package meupacote;

import javax...servlet.jsp.JspWriter; // servlet não aparece
import javax...servlet.jsp.tagext.TagSupport; // servlet não aparece

public class InputTag extends TagSupport 
{

}

Obrigado.

4 Respostas

edu_merckx

passei por esse problema e resolvi colocando o arquivo servlet-api.jar na pasta /WEB-INF/lib…

leorbarbosa

Tentei,

mas o problema continua.

rogelgarcia

O arquivo servlet-api.jar tem que estar no classpath da aplicacao… (provavelmente esse é o problema mesmo)

No entando vc nao deve colocar o servlet-api.jar dentro do WEB-INF/lib

Esse jar deve ser fornecido pelo servidor em runtime… nao pela app…

Alguns servidores podem até achar ruim e nao iniciar se vc tiver esse jar dentro do lib…

edu_merckx

vlw rogelgarcia… eu já tinha percebido que o próprio Tomcat possui esse arquivo… só não entendia porque às vezes dava o erro mencionado pelo leorbarbosa…

até mais…

Criado 10 de julho de 2010
Ultima resposta 10 de jul. de 2010
Respostas 4
Participantes 3